Abstract

The utility model discloses an adsorb massage shower nozzle and massage device, including inlet tube and drainage tube, the drainage tube cross-under is in the inlet tube, the one end of inlet tube forms into the water inlet end, the other end of inlet tube forms into the installation end, the one end of drainage tube forms into the drainage end, the other end of drainage tube forms out the water end, the outer wall of drainage end and the inner wall interval of inlet end form the drainage interval; the outer wall of the water outlet end is in sealing fit with the inner wall of the mounting end; the inner wall of the drainage end is provided with a drainage port; the drainage port is communicated with the drainage interval and guides water flow to be guided in along the tangent line of the drainage end. The massage device comprises a massage container and the adsorption massage spray head. The utility model can guide the water flow to be guided out in a vortex shape, and can massage when having the adsorption effect.

Description

Adsorption massage nozzle and massage device
Technical Field
The utility model relates to a massage articles for use technical field especially relates to adsorb massage shower nozzle and massage device.
Background
At present, the living pressure of urban people is increased, and people need to relax during rest, such as massage, bath, foot bath and the like, so that products such as foot bath basins, massage jars and the like enter the market. The foot tub and the massage tub are required to perform a punching massage on the feet or the whole body of the human body by flowing water. However, in the case of the foot tub, the foot is massaged by spraying pressure on the sole of the foot through a massage nozzle, but in the process, the foot needs to be massaged by being stationary on the water column or moving the massage nozzle relative to the water column, and the whole process needs to control the position of the foot, so that the experience is not comfortable enough.

Detailed Description
The invention will be further described with reference to the accompanying drawings and specific embodiments:
in the case of the example 1, the following examples are given,
the adsorption massage nozzle 100 shown in fig. 1 to 4 includes a water inlet pipe 10 and a drainage pipe 20, the drainage pipe 20 is threaded into the water inlet pipe 10, one end of the water inlet pipe 10 is formed as a water inlet end 11, and the other end of the water inlet pipe 10 is formed as a mounting end 12. And one end of the draft tube 20 is formed as a drainage end 21 and the other end of the draft tube 20 is formed as a water outlet end 22.
After assembly, the outer wall of the drainage end 21 is spaced from the inner wall of the water inlet end 11 to form a drainage space 13, and the outer wall of the water outlet end 22 is in sealing fit with the inner wall of the mounting end 12. Particularly, the inner wall of the drainage end 21 is provided with a drainage opening 24, the drainage opening 24 can be communicated with the drainage interval 13, and water flow is guided into the drainage end 21 along the tangent line.
On the basis of the above structure, when the adsorption massage nozzle 100 of the present invention is used, the adsorption massage nozzle 100 can be applied to the main body such as the massage basin 200 or the massage cylinder, and the application of the adsorption massage nozzle 100 to the massage basin 200 is specifically described in this embodiment as an example.
When the massage basin is used, the water inlet pipe 10 is assembled at the bottom end of the massage basin 200, the water inlet end 11 of the water inlet pipe 10 can be connected with an external water pipe, water is guided into the drainage interval 13, water in the drainage interval 13 can enter the drainage end 21 through the drainage port 24, the drainage port 24 can guide the water to enter in a tangent line mode, the inner diameter of the drainage pipe 20 is gradually increased from the drainage end 21 to the water outlet end 22, the tangentially-guided water can be guided out from the drainage end 21 to the water outlet end 22 along the inner wall of the drainage pipe 20 to form a vortex, the vortex center can form negative pressure adsorption, the water flow can be guided out to perform massage, and massage is performed while adsorption is performed.
Since the relationship between the flow rate, the flow velocity, and the cross section is q ═ v × s, the flow velocity is smaller as the cross section is larger when the water flow rate is the same, and therefore, the flow velocity of the water flow introduced tangentially is smaller, and the flow velocity is smaller, and therefore, the water pressure formed is also smaller, so that a negative pressure can be formed at the center of the drainage tube 20 to adsorb the sole, and the water flow rising up in a vortex can impact-massage the sole, so that the foot can be better adsorbed at the bottom of the massage tub 200 and massaged.
Further, the absorption massage nozzle 100 further comprises a cover plate 30, a water outlet 31 is arranged on the cover plate 30, the cover plate 30 is covered on the water outlet end 22 and is connected with the mounting end 12, the inner diameter of the water outlet 31 is smaller than that of the water outlet end 22, and on the basis of the structure, when water flow in the drainage tube 20 is guided out from bottom to top, the water flow can be closed up through the water outlet 31 with a relatively smaller inner diameter, so that the flow rate formed at the outlet is relatively large, the pressure is relatively large, and the massage force is better. It should be noted that, since the water flow in the draft tube 20 below the cover plate 30 is a vortex flow, the center pressure is always kept low, and the suction force is not affected by the arrangement of the cover plate 30.
Of course, the cover plate 30 can be made of soft rubber such as silica gel or rubber, so that the adsorption force is increased, and the sole of the foot is more comfortable to contact.
Further, in order to facilitate the assembly of the cover plate 30, a supporting slot 25 may be provided at the top end of the water outlet end 22; the bottom end of the cover plate 30 is provided with a supporting portion 32, the supporting portion 32 is surrounded at the periphery of the water outlet 31, when the cover plate 30 is assembled, the supporting portion 32 of the cover plate 30 can be inserted into the supporting groove 25, so that the cover plate 30 covers the water outlet end 22, and the water outlet of the water outlet 31 is not affected. In addition, the peripheral edge of the cover plate 30 extends downwards to form a cover part 33, and the cover part 33 can be sleeved on the peripheral edge of the mounting end 12, that is, the assembly of the cover plate 30 can be positioned by the cooperation of the bearing part 32 and the bearing groove 25 and the peripheral edge of the cover part 33 and the mounting end 12, and the assembly structure is more stable.
In this embodiment, the inner diameter of the draft tube 20 gradually increases from the drainage end 21 to the water outlet end 22.
Specifically, a first drainage section and a second drainage section are formed in the drainage tube 20, the first drainage section is located at the drainage end 21, the second drainage section is located at the water outlet end 22, the inner diameter of the first drainage section is smaller than that of the second drainage section, and the drainage port 24 is formed in the inner wall of the first drainage section. Have two sections first drainage sections and second drainage sections that the pipe diameter differs in drainage tube 20 in this embodiment promptly, the velocity of flow is littleer after flowing to the second drainage section in rivers in first drainage section, and the water pressure of formation is littleer, adsorbs more easily.
Of course, besides the above structure, a conical surface can be arranged in the drainage tube 20, and the purpose of increasing the tube diameter from small to large can also be achieved.
More specifically, still can be equipped with drainage boss 23 at the protruding middle part in first drainage section, the outer wall of this drainage boss 23 can set up with the inner wall interval of first drainage section, so, the rivers that get into in the first drainage section can be around drainage boss 23 outside the drainage, are convenient for form the vortex in the center.
Further, still can be equipped with the inlet port on drainage tube 20, when using the absorption massage shower nozzle 100 of this application in the massage jar, because the massage jar is bathe and is used, therefore needs sufficient papaw, can lead to the air current through the inlet port on drainage tube 20, also can carry out the atmospheric pressure massage when forming sufficient papaw.
Further, the outer wall of the water outlet end 22 may be provided with a mounting groove, a sealing ring 40 is disposed in the mounting groove, and the sealing ring 40 is spaced from the inner wall of the mounting end 12, so that the outer wall of the water outlet end 22 of the drainage tube 20 and the inner wall of the mounting end 12 of the water inlet tube 10 can be sealed by the sealing ring 40, thereby ensuring that water flow is guided into the drainage port 24.
Specifically, in this embodiment, see fig. 4, can be equipped with drainage inclined plane 26 at the outer wall of drainage end 21, locate drainage inclined plane 26 in the outside of drainage mouth 24, so, when the water in drainage interval 13 is led in, can block through drainage inclined plane 26, make rivers get into by drainage mouth 24 lateral part, the leading-in rivers of drainage mouth 24 of being convenient for are tangent line leading-in.
Of course, the drainage openings 24 are provided in plurality, and the plurality of drainage openings 24 are circumferentially distributed around the central axis of the drainage tube 20 at intervals, that is, the introduced water flow is relatively more, and the massage effect is better. In addition, the outer wall of the mounting end 12 of the water inlet pipe 10 may be provided with an external thread, which is screwed to the bottom of the massage basin 200, so as to facilitate the assembly and disassembly.
Under other circumstances, do not have above-mentioned external screw thread structure, also can directly be at the installation end outer wall coating glue layer, directly glue the installation end veneer of inlet tube in the bottom of massage basin through glue.
